She was making Moonlight Sonata, about her deaf son learning the Beethoven piece, and in the middle of production her dad, also deaf, started showing signs of dementia. So it became a different story than what was originally intended. Became a film about 3 people dealing with hearing loss in very different times/ circumstances, and both Beethoven and her dad losing something very key to who they were - Beethoven his hearing, and her dad (an inventor & professor), his mind.
Obviously this was very vulnerable because it’s her own family, not just any doc subject. So I think she’s in a good position to handle the situation that unfolded around Céline.
